<Title>Reflections of a Green Intern</Title>
<Tagline>i'm not good at introductions but its about sustainability</Tagline>
<Body>
<![CDATA[
    <div class="html-content">
    <p>I can't properly articulate my job description as a UMBC France-Merrick Foundation intern. The position certainly has sustainability and environmental consciousness at its core, but the responsibilities and privileges that come with it are so varied that its difficult to place them into boxes. I've been able to spearhead initiatives that are transforming the way UMBC students commute. I've been part of diverse teams that are evolving the way UMBC handles its waste. I've seen students transform ground-breaking ideas into projects that have earned funding and are going to become realities in the upcoming semester. The common denominator of the experience thus far, however, has been working with a community.</p>
    <p>Working with the Sustainability Matters initiative has allowed me to become part of a community that seeks to make UMBC beautiful. We've been able to divert more waste from landfills to compost. We've created a new community for cyclists at UMBC by introducing new public facilities and more opportunities for students to get access to bikes through the Retriever Fleet. The Green Office Program has established a fantastic way for entire departments on campus to commit to energy conservation. We've organized festivals, classes and student groups committed to sustainability at UMBC. Fall 2014 was certainly a successful semester. </p>
    <p>I'm grateful to be a part of such an amazing program. I'm grateful to be able to lead and create. I'm grateful to be able to work with an amazing student body to create and crush innovative goals. 2015 is going to introduce new opportunities for commuters to have better parking access. The already upgraded cycling program is going to grow and evolve to suit the needs of more students. Healthier food options are going to continue to be introduced on campus and waste reduction programs are going to continue to grow until we've all but eliminated our landfill contributions. Simply put: we won't stop crushing it because we had a good year. </p>

    <p>Late Spring is the start of the ground-level ozone season, when we hear about Code Red and Orange Ozone Action Days. On these warm smoggy days, the air is dangerous to breathe – especially for the young and for the elderly. Emissions from single occupancy vehicles(driving alone) contribute approximately 20% of our region's dangerous ozone levels. Driving alone also results in increasingly congested roadways and parking issues. We can save money, protect the environment, stay in shape and have fun while biking.</p>
    <p>Transportation accounts for 38% of UMBC's carbon footprint. In 2007, President Hrabowski committed to campus carbon neutrality.</p>

<Title>Commons' New Waste Bins: Learn about Composting on Campus!</Title>
<Tagline>All About Compost: Learn How, Who, Why &amp; Where @UMBC!</Tagline>
<Body>
<![CDATA[
    <div class="html-content">
    <blockquote>
    <p>As you returned or arrived to campus in the fall, you may have seen the new waste bins (including compost!) in the Commons. In case you were wondering, here's how they came to be, and how you can use them! Help us spread the word by sharing this post with your networks: <a href="http://sustainability.umbc.edu/waste" rel="nofollow external" class="bo"><span>http://sustainability.umbc.edu/<span>waste</span></span></a></p>
    <p><a href="http://sustainability.umbc.edu/waste/thumbnail/" rel="nofollow external" class="bo">Check out this illustrated guide from OCSS for sorting recycling, composting and waste (printable PDF)</a></p>
    <img src="http://sustainability.umbc.edu/files/2013/08/thumbnail.png" height="586" width="463" style="max-width: 100%; height: auto;"><p><a href="http://sustainability.umbc.edu/waste/281011_10151281993946539_1487753444_o/" rel="nofollow external" class="bo"><img alt="281011_10151281993946539_1487753444_o" src="http://sustainability.umbc.edu/files/2013/08/281011_10151281993946539_1487753444_o.jpg" height="200" width="258" style="max-width: 100%; height: auto;"></a><br></p>
    <p>UMBC's new bins have 3 or 4 slots:</p>
    <ol>
    <li>Paper</li>
    <li>Landfill</li>
    <li>Compostable <em>(Commons &amp; UC only)</em>
    </li>
    <li>Glass, Cans, Plastic</li>
    </ol>
    <p>The
     labels are available as stickers as well, to show and explain how waste
     should be sorted. The new bins are located in the Commons, and at 
    lecture halls, and will be phased in across campus as a new indoor standard. Outdoor recycling 
    bins (the black, metal, circular bins) accept all recyclables: paper, glass,
     cans and plastic.</p>

    <h3>Compost</h3>
    <p>Learn about compostable packaging: </p>
    <h3><strong>What can we compost?</strong></h3>
    <ul>
    <li>All Food Waste</li>
    <li>Soiled Paper Products (such as used napkins, pizza boxes, etc. If you notice a plastic or wax coating, toss into the landfill slot for general trash)</li>
    <li>Plant-based Packaging (just check the labels and images below)</li>
    </ul>
    <h3>
    <a href="http://sustainability.umbc.edu/waste/compost/" rel="nofollow external" class="bo"><img alt="compost" src="http://sustainability.umbc.edu/files/2013/08/compost-300x194.jpg" height="191" width="296" style="max-width: 100%; height: auto;"></a><br>
    </h3>
    <h3>
    <a href="http://sustainability.umbc.edu/waste/pepsico-eco-friendly-cups-300x300/" rel="nofollow external" class="bo"><img alt="PepsiCo-Eco-Friendly-Cups-300x300" src="http://sustainability.umbc.edu/files/2013/08/PepsiCo-Eco-Friendly-Cups-300x300-150x150.jpg" height="150" width="150" style="max-width: 100%; height: auto;"></a><br>
    </h3>
    <h3><a href="http://sustainability.umbc.edu/waste/gpinklemonade-223x350/" rel="nofollow external" class="bo"><img alt="GPinkLemonade-223x350" src="http://sustainability.umbc.edu/files/2013/08/GPinkLemonade-223x350-150x150.jpg" height="150" width="150" style="max-width: 100%; height: auto;"></a></h3>
    <h3></h3>
    <strong>Where can we compost?</strong><ul>
    <li>True Grits Dining Hall (all food waste is composted in the kitchen, including food on used dishes)</li>
    <li>
    <a href="http://www.umbc.edu/commons/" rel="nofollow external" class="bo">The Commons (labeled green slots in waste bins)</a><br>
    </li>
    <li>University Center (ground floor by dining options)</li>
    </ul>
    <p><strong>Why Compost?</strong></p>
    <p>Composting
     allows food to decompose naturally into valuable fertile soil. Otherwise, food 
    waste decomposing in a landfill without oxygen would create methane, a 
    problematic greenhouse gas contributing to climate change. <a href="http://www.epa.gov/compost/basic.htm" rel="nofollow external" class="bo">Learn more at epa.gov</a>!</p>
    <blockquote>
    <p><strong>History: Collaboration and Coordination</strong></p>
    <p>We were able to start composting our food waste in 2012 thanks to the efforts of <a href="http://sga.umbc.edu/" rel="nofollow external" class="bo">SGA</a> Sustainability Intern Madeline Hall (featured in the composting video below), and a coordinating committee including student leaders, our dining provider <a href="http://www.dineoncampus.com/umbc/show.cfm?cmd=sustainability" rel="nofollow external" class="bo">Chartwells</a>, contract coordinators <a href="http://campuscard.umbc.edu/" rel="nofollow external" class="bo">Campus Card</a>, our <a href="http://www.abm.com/why-abm/white-papers/pages/green-cleaning-programs.aspx" rel="nofollow external" class="bo">green housekeeping group</a>, and the company who picks up our compost and returns the decomposed food as fertile soil, <a href="http://www.wasteneutral.com" rel="nofollow external" class="bo">Waste Neutral</a>, as well as <a href="http://www.umbc.edu/fm/energy/recycling.html" rel="nofollow external" class="bo">Facilities Management</a> and UMBC's <a href="http://sustainability.umbc.edu" rel="nofollow external" class="bo">Sustainability Coordinator</a>! <br></p>
    <p>Composting has been phased into food services since 2012, starting with
     the Dining hall, then the Commons- to allow time to collaboratively 
    select, purchase, and install new user friendly bins, to become a 
    standard across campus.</p>
    <strong>Awareness: Events, Promotions and Education</strong><p>Our student partners
     such as Students for Environmental Awareness, SGA Department of 
    Environmental Affairs and SGA Sustainability interns have taken the lead in the 2012-2013 school year and designed educational outreach programs to raise awareness on why and how
     to compost on campus since composting was first introduced on campus! <br></p>

<Title>Dr. Turner's course on Sustainability: eco-literacy @ UMBC</Title>
<Body>
<![CDATA[
    <div class="html-content">
    <h2>Eco-Education</h2>
    <p>A first-year seminar class offered this semester is giving students the 
    chance to explore environmental issues from a humanities perspective. The class, 
    Sustainability in American Culture, focuses on eco-literacy; that is, an 
    awareness of how cultural influences can affect our relationship with the 
    environment. 
    </p>
    <p>“In a humanities course, it’s possible to think about thing like culture, 
    discourse and language and how those things shape our thinking and how our 
    thinking shapes our interaction with the environment and the natural world,” 
    said <strong>Rita Turner</strong>, ’11 Ph.D., language, literacy and culture, 
    who is teaching the class. Turner’s dissertation is based on developing 
    curriculum to cultivate environmental awareness in high school and college 
    students, so when she heard that the university was testing the idea of having 
    graduate students teach first-year seminars she jumped at the chance to use her 
    materials.</p>
    <p>The class allows students to approach environmental issues from multiple 
    perspectives, rather than just learning the science of the environment. For 
    example, students read about how everyday items are produced, wrote creative 
    pieces from the perspective of nonhuman beings in the environment and created 
    digital stories about places.</p>
    <p>“We look critically about what’s said in the media, how our attitudes are 
    shaped, what metaphors we use to talk about the natural world and what rights we 
    have,” said Turner. By discussing popular discourse on the environment, Turner 
    hopes to empower her students—many of whom are science majors who plan to work 
    on environmental issues —to understand and critique the range of factors that 
    contribute to our attitudes about the environment.</p>
    <p>“I like the fact that we can step into the gray areas instead of being in the 
    black-and-white place that we normally are when it comes to classes and 
    answers,” said <strong>Heather Harshbarger</strong> ’14, chemical 
    engineering.</p>
    <p> “I was surprised at how much information the class covered,” said 
    <strong>Jennie Williams</strong> ’14, social work. “Not only did the curriculum 
    focus on conservation, but it also explored consumerism, corporate power, 
    political influence and even art and creative reflection in nature.”</p>
    <p>Williams, an avid recycler and vegetarian, said that she was aware of 
    environmental issues before taking the class but that it has expanded her view 
    of these issues. “I have definitely become more aware of consumerism in the 
    American culture and it has motivated me to stay active in education and 
    projects of environmental protection,” she said.</p>
    <p>Turner said that teaching the class has helped her to hone the curriculum 
    that she will present with her dissertation, and she looks forward to being able 
    to share what she learned in a real classroom with her dissertation committee. 
    Teaching the class has reinforced her belief that students should learn to think 
    critically about the environment. “This sort of humanities piece of the puzzle 
    is missing, and I feel like there’s a real need for that,” she said.</p>

<Title>UMBC President summarizes our advances in sustainability</Title>
<Tagline>Dr Hrabowski on UMBC's progress &amp; efforts in sustainability</Tagline>
<Body>
<![CDATA[
    <div class="html-content">
    <p>From the 2013 Legislative Testimony, Dr Freeman Hrabowski, III, UMBC President</p>
    <h5><strong><em>SUSTAINABILITY</em></strong></h5>
    <p>Our campus community is working to address global warming every day. Through our research and academic programs, we are producing knowledge and a new generation of informed citizens and leaders to move Maryland and the nation toward dramatically reduced emissions of greenhouse gases.  We are part of the American College &amp; University Presidents’ Climate Commitment.  Our Climate Change Task Force has developed an action plan and is actively implementing projects to reduce our carbon footprint on campus and beyond. Through climate change initiatives, the campus has reduced its net emissions by 13.3% over the past five years, a major reduction considering the 15% increase in enrollment and 2% increase in campus square footage during this time period. The additional square footage includes a LEED Gold Certified addition to Patapsco Residence Hall, complete with our campus’s first green roof, as well as Phase 1 of our new Performing Arts and Humanities Building built to LEED Silver standards.</p>
    <p>As of 2012, 20% of UMBC’s electricity comes from renewable resources, utilizing our long-term contract with the University System of Maryland.  A Chilled Water Optimization project significantly improves the efficiency of the Central Plant and cooling for most of the campus, reducing annual energy usage by 5,700,000 kWh and reducing annual Greenhouse Gas emissions by 3,100 metric tons eCO2.  Relative to a baseline year of 2007, this represents a 7% reduction in electricity and 3.5% reduction in carbon footprint.</p>
    <p>UMBC hired its first full-time Environmental Sustainability Coordinator in 2012, and the Student Government Association is funding five sustainability interns this year. Student participation in a new composting program and in Recyclemania, a 10-week national competition involving 400 colleges and universities, has boosted the campus’s recycling rate to 28%.  The university has also made significant advances in green transportation initiatives, including optimizing UMBC transit service routes and schedules,  a new carpooling policy, improved vanpooling and public transit options, and improvements to make the campus more bike- and pedestrian-friendly.</p>

<Title>UMBC leads in environmental science &amp; tech. research</Title>
<Tagline>Dr Hrabowski extols UMBC's advances &amp; in earth sciences</Tagline>
<Body>
<![CDATA[
    <div class="html-content">
    <p>From the 2013 Legislative Testimony, Dr Freeman Hrabowski, III, UMBC President</p>
    <p> </p>
    <p>According to the Higher Education Research &amp; Development Survey, the campus ranks 18<sup>th</sup> nationally in <strong>environmental</strong> <strong>science</strong> research and development expenditures.   We recently launched the Goddard Planetary Heliophysics Institute (GPHI) through a Cooperative Agreement with the NASA Goddard Space Flight Center (GSFC) in Greenbelt, Maryland.  Based at GSFC, GPHI is a center for collaborative research in solar-planetary sciences linking researchers from UMBC, the University of Maryland, College Park, and American University. The Institute focuses on phenomena ranging from solar wind to sunspots, including the effects that weather on the Sun can have on Earth and our orbiting satellites.</p>
    <p><a href="http://president.umbc.edu/legislative-testimony-2013/fig8/" rel="nofollow external" class="bo"><img alt="Environmental Science Research Expenditures" src="http://president.umbc.edu/files/2013/02/fig8.png" width="428" height="333" style="max-width: 100%; height: auto;"></a></p>
    <p>The recent realignment of the former University of Maryland Biotechnology Institute faculty has brought many new scientific and technology-development assets to UMBC.  <strong>Maryland</strong> <strong>Sustainable</strong> <strong>Mariculture</strong> (<strong>MSM</strong>), a spin-off company founded by UMBC marine biotechnology faculty, is currently negotiating with a group of international investors who plan to lease space at the Columbus Center in downtown Baltimore to model marine aquaculture in a public display.  Plasmonix, a biotechnology start-up based on technologies licensed from the Institute of Fluorescence, recently received venture capital from the Governor’s “<strong>Invest</strong> <strong>Maryland</strong> <strong>Challenge</strong>” and is now located at <em>bwtech@</em>UMBC<em>, </em>our research and technology park.  In addition, our core facilities in mass spectrometry, imaging, and high-performance computing support both faculty research and companies. We work aggressively to create multi-level partnerships that connect faculty and students with companies, agencies, foundations, and school systems – and these partnerships enable us to leverage State funds.  For example, we have developed major research centers and other partnerships with support from NASA and from IBM, Lockheed Martin, Northrop Grumman, SAIC, Wyeth Pharmaceuticals, the Department of Defense, the National Security Agency (NSA), and other organizations.  Other partnerships with Federal and State agencies have allowed us to leverage State funds and contribute to the policy arena in gerontology (through the Erickson School for Aging, Management, and Policy and the Center for Aging Studies), the environment (through our <strong>Center</strong> <strong>for</strong> <strong>Urban</strong> <strong>Environmental</strong> <strong>Research</strong> <strong>&amp; Education</strong> – <strong>CUERE</strong>), health care (through our Hilltop Institute), and teacher education (through the Center for History Education, the Center for Excellence in STEM Education, and the <strong>Maryland</strong> <strong>Geographic</strong> <strong>Alliance</strong>).</p>

<Title>Recirculating aquaculture to farm fish more sustainably</Title>
<Tagline>UMBC&#8217;s Dept. of Marine Biotech. is taking on the challenge</Tagline>
<Body>
<![CDATA[
    <div class="html-content">
    <h1>Fishing Without a Net</h1>
    <div>
    <p><img alt="Fishing Without a Net" src="http://www.umbc.edu/magazine/winter11/images/fishing_topimage.jpg" style="max-width: 100%; height: auto;"></p>
    <p><strong><em>In UMBC’s Department of Marine Biotechnology, Yonathan Zohar and his colleagues are creating sustainable fish farms that may revolutionize our notions of fishing and seafood. </em></strong></p>
    <p>Source: UMBC Magazine</p>
    <p><em>- By Anthony Lane </em></p>
    <p>A well-known proverb appears on a wall near the entrance to the Columbus Center on Baltimore’s Inner Harbor: <em>Give a man a fish, he eats for a day. Teach a man to fish and he eats for a lifetime.</em></p>
    <p>A worthy sentiment, yes. But what happens if we use up the bounty of the world’s oceans and seas? Talk for a few minutes with aquaculture pioneer Yonathan Zohar and you might be moved to coin a new proverb:</p>
    <p><em>Teach too many people to fish, and there might one day be nothing left to catch.</em></p>
    <p>Zohar is chair of UMBC’s new Department of Marine Biotechnology. At the Columbus Center, he and his colleagues develop new techniques and technologies to protect the world’s oceans and seas and preserve the life inside them.</p>
    <p><img alt="Fish image" src="http://www.umbc.edu/magazine/winter11/images/fishing_subimage1.jpg" style="max-width: 100%; height: auto;"></p>
    <p>Pollution, climate change and gushing oil wells are all threats to aquatic systems. But even the act of fishing itself has advanced to a point of deadly efficiency: high-tech fishing fleets use spotters in airplanes and other techniques to maximize their catch and meet a growing global demand for seafood.</p>
    <p>“If we don’t do anything about it,” Zohar observes, “the oceans could be out of 90 percent-plus of the major fishery stocks by the year 2050.” Many fisheries are already in serious trouble in 2011, he adds: “Cod used to be one of the most abundant fish out there. Now the cod fishery is almost gone. The giant bluefin tuna has been fished almost beyond repair.”</p>
    <p>One answer to overfishing of natural waters is fish farms. But much of the news there is also troubling. Marine fish such as salmon and sea bass are typically raised in offshore floating net pens, where they cause pollution, absorb toxins, and exchange diseases with their wild cousins. Selectively bred farmed fish sometimes escape from their pens, displacing the natives or getting cozy with them.</p>
    <p>So where will seafood come from in the future?</p>
    <p>Zohar and his colleagues think they have an answer: a sustainable aquaculture system that they have developed in the Columbus Center’s basement. It uses a system of filters and pumps to clean and recirculate artificial seawater, providing ideal conditions for marine fish to grow and breed in safety. The fish can’t escape, and the design eliminates the risk of transmitting diseases or polluting coastal waters. Even the fish wastes are put to productive use: they are converted to methane, which can be used to help power the whole aquaculture system.</p>
    <p>Humans have domesticated an array of animals and plants over the course of centuries to meet most of our food needs, Zohar observes. That still hasn’t happened with seafood.</p>
    <p>“You don’t go to the wild to catch poultry or bovines,” he says. “Seafood is the only hunt-and-gather crop.”</p>
    <p>Zohar believes that the aquaculture system at the Columbus Center – which could be used in landlocked Iowa just as easily as it can be used near the Inner Harbor – could be a green, clean and efficient way to raise fish anywhere.</p>
    <p><strong>A Tricky Business</strong></p>
    <p>Zohar grew up in Jerusalem, and he developed an early fascination with oceans and marine life studying magazines such as <em>National Geographic</em>. Though he was close to the Mediterranean Sea all his life, it was not until he was teenager that he first visited the water during a school trip to the beach. “I loved it from first sight,” he says.</p>
    <p>This passion for the sea eventually brought Zohar to Baltimore. In 1990, he joined the Center of Marine Biotechnology at the University System of Maryland to conduct aquaculture research. He later became the director of that center, remaining in that position until July 2010, when the center became the Institute of Marine and Environmental Technology (IMET), a partnership between UMBC, the University of Maryland Center for Environmental Science and the University of Maryland, Baltimore. Zohar continued on as IMET’s interim director, and he is chair of the new Department of Marine Biotechnology at UMBC.</p>
    <p>Aquaculture was in its early stages when Zohar studied biology as an undergraduate at the Hebrew University of Jerusalem. Completing his master’s degree in oceanography in the mid-1970s, the young researcher started working at a national lab in Israel dedicated to developing techniques for raising marine fish such as European sea bass and sea bream. But progress in aquaculture in that era was stalled by a roadblock: The fish would not reproduce in captivity.</p>
    <p>“We had to go collect juvenile fish in the wild,” Zohar recalls. “It was very clear this was not practical or reliable.”</p>
    <p>Zohar eventually became an expert in reproduction, completing his Ph.D. in comparative endocrinology at the University of Pierre and Marie Curie in Paris in 1982. Reproduction is a tricky business with marine fish. In the wild, they will migrate hundreds or even thousands of miles to reach the spawning grounds where their offspring are most likely to survive. During these migrations, changes in temperature, water depth, salinity and other environmental factors essentially serve as an elemental sort of foreplay. The fish spawn only when these conditions are just right.</p>
    <p>One way around the reproduction roadblock would be to mimic these environmental conditions in captivity. This approach wasn’t working, so Zohar decided to try something different, examining instead how the fishes’ hormonal systems respond to the environmental changes that lead to reproduction.</p>
    <p>In an effort to understand why fish held in confinement fail to reproduce, Zohar’s research team collected spawning fish from the wild to compare them with their captive, reproductively challenged cousins. It became clear that a surge of a particular hormone resulted in spawning. His group traced the failure of captive fish to release this hormone to a malfunction in a related hormone system in the brain that produces what are known as gonadotropin-releasing hormones (GnRHs). They eventually found completely new forms of GnRH, a breakthrough that spurred reproductive research in animals and humans.</p>
    <p>Zohar and his colleagues learned to synthesize a specific type of GnRH, and they discovered that injecting it into captive fish would trigger the reproductive response. Or the start of it, at least. After the injection, it turned out that enzymes in the fish would naturally break the hormone apart. So Zohar’s team spent a period of years developing a novel form of the hormone resistant to that process. They also engineered a “sustained delivery system” so that the hormone could be released at just the right pace to induce spawning.</p>
    <p>That approach effectively cleared a path for the field of aquaculture to develop. In the recent <em>New York Times</em> bestseller <em>Four Fish</em>, Paul Greenberg details Zohar’s aquaculture research, characterizing his impact in bold terms. “Over the years he has gained a reputation as one of the world’s best at cracking the reproductive codes of the marine world.”</p>
    <p><strong>A Sustainable System</strong></p>
    <p><img alt="Zohar" src="http://www.umbc.edu/magazine/winter11/images/fishing_subimage2.jpg" width="265" height="195" style="max-width: 100%; height: auto;"></p>
    <p>Challenges in marine aquaculture are not limited to reproduction. For a system to be sustainable, it must be engineered to reproduce in miniature the microbial processes that support life in the oceans.</p>
    <p>The system Zohar and his colleagues have developed over the last 15 years now sprawls across 18,000 square feet in the Columbus Center’s basement. Zohar beams proudly as he leads tours through the facility, explaining how it defines a new level of sophistication in aquaculture systems.</p>
    <p>“Ours is the first system in the world to be fully and completely self-contained,” Zohar says.</p>
    <p>The Columbus Center is only two blocks from the National Aquarium in downtown Baltimore, and its aquaculture facility feels in many ways like an industrial version of its tourist-oriented neighbor. Massive round tanks brim with European sea bass, sea bream, cobia and other fish species. The fish circle intently, abruptly striking with open mouths when Zohar throws in a handful of food pellets.</p>
    <p>Next to each tank, water churns through towering filtration units filled with what appear to be wagon-wheel pasta pieces. A labyrinth of pipes and tubes connects with a web of filters and sensors to keep the water within healthy limits for the fish.</p>
    <p>The “seawater” in the tanks is actually manufactured; the system starts with dechlorinated tap water, which is mixed with salt and other trace elements to simulate what is found in the oceans. In this water, the fish go about their daily business, leaving behind wasted food and producing ammonia and feces that would soon turn the water into inhospitable sludge.</p>
    <p>A network of filtration systems keeps the water in pristine condition. The first separates out the food and feces, producing a viscous, salty sludge. In freshwater systems, the sludge can be used as fertilizer. This can cause pollution, however, and it’s not an option given the leftover salt in marine systems.</p>
    <p>Enter <strong>Kevin Sowers</strong>, a professor in the Department of Marine Biotechnology who is an expert on methane-producing bacteria. Over the years, he has helped find a blend of organisms that can effectively devour the sludge created in the Columbus Center aquaculture system and convert it into methane.</p>
    <p>“It’s very critical that all these organisms stay in balance,” Sowers observes. And when they do, 90 percent of the waste can be converted to methane.</p>
    <p>The aquaculture system developed by Zohar and the marine biotechnology team has already been licensed to a private company for commercial production. When that system is up and running, Sowers says, it should be able to meet at least five to 10 percent of its electricity needs by burning this methane.</p>
    <p>The other major waste product created by the system is ammonia. It’s relatively simple to convert ammonia into less toxic nitrogen compounds: Those filters filled with wagon-wheel-shaped pieces are designed specifically for this purpose. The plastic pieces are coated with a film of bacteria that thrive on ammonia, converting it into the nitrogen compounds nitrite and nitrate.</p>
    <p>That’s only part of the process, however. The nitrogen compounds build up in the system over time. The nitrate, in particular, renders the water toxic. To get rid of it, aquarium owners and the operators of other land-based aquaculture systems are accustomed to frequently changing their water, but doing that in a commercial marine aquaculture system would be both costly and unsustainable.</p>
    <p>Marine biotechnology faculty members <strong>Hal Schreier</strong> and <strong>Keiko Saito</strong>, along with other colleagues at the Columbus Center, developed a parallel filtration system that keeps the nitrate in check.</p>
    <p>This system amounts to something of a high-wire act. Sulfate is a compound that occurs naturally in aquaculture systems, but aquaculture engineers have shied away from trying to use it productively due to an undesirable side reaction that produces toxic hydrogen sulfide, which could turn the water into an acidic broth.</p>
    <p>The Columbus Center aquaculture system harnesses that reaction. Hydrogen sulfide is produced in one step by the bacteria residing in one waste chamber, and the compound is then channeled to another chamber where it is available to a special crop of finicky bacteria. Some of these bacteria consume a cocktail of hydrogen sulfide and nitrate, and churn out sulfate, hydrogen and harmless nitrogen gas in the process.</p>
    <p>“We used the process that everyone wanted to avoid,” Schreier explains, “and we turned it to our advantage.”</p>
    <p><strong>Fishing for the Future</strong></p>
    <p>So where does the aquaculture system developed by Zohar and his colleagues go from here?</p>
    <p>Adapting it to a commercial scale is one challenge. It could happen soon: A start-up company called Maryland Sustainable Mariculture has licensed the technology and is now looking for warehouse space that can accommodate an expanded operation. Zohar and his team will help with that effort.</p>
    <p>Schreier says there are still parts of the innovative set-up that could be fine-tuned. Though the present aquaculture system minimizes pollution, it still produces a minimal amount of phosphate. The compound shows up as white flakes that must be collected and removed.</p>
    <p>Schreier imagines that researchers will one day find a chemical or biological pathway to eliminate this waste product.</p>
    <p>Marine biotechnology members are also continuing research on other fronts, including the use of bacteria to break down contaminants in the ocean, the development of algae that can be used in the production of biofuels and the exploration of the seas as a source of new pharmaceuticals.</p>
    <p>Zohar envisions a future where aquaculture and marine biotechnology both contribute to the health of the world’s oceans.</p>
    <p>“We have too many fishermen,” Zohar says, “and too many fishing boats.”</p>
    <p>For now, anyway. Zohar predicts a more sustainable future: “Fishermen, I think, can readily become aquaculturists.”</p>

<Title>Research Scientist reduces runoff protecting Chesapeake Bay</Title>
<Tagline>Schwartz reduces compaction of soil, increasing infiltration</Tagline>
<Body>
<![CDATA[
    <div class="html-content">
    <h3>GREEN AND CLEAN</h3>
    <p>Can Maryland’s green spaces help keep the Chesapeake Bay cleaner?</p>
    <p><a href="http://umbcmagazine.files.wordpress.com/2013/02/discovery_soil_win13.jpg" rel="nofollow external" class="bo"><img alt="discovery_soil_win13" src="http://umbcmagazine.files.wordpress.com/2013/02/discovery_soil_win13.jpg?w=940&amp;h=562" width="470" height="281" style="max-width: 100%; height: auto;"></a></p>
    <p>Source: UMBC Magazine</p>
    <p><strong>Stuart S. Schwartz</strong>, a senior research scientist at UMBC’s Center for Urban Environmental Research and Education (CUERE) is developing new methods that may help minimize potentially harmful runoff from green spaces into the Chesapeake Bay.</p>
    <p>“What we find when you look around at construction sites is the way that we develop the landscape deeply disturbs [the soil],” says Schwartz.</p>
    <p>One particular culprit is soil compaction, which allows runoff to flow more readily into the Chesapeake Bay or other bodies of water. So Schwartz and his team have devised a plan to loosen urban soils and mix them with vegetative compost to create a thicker, deeper soil that also allows more rainfall to infiltrate it and be retained in the soil, thus producing less runoff.</p>
    <p>Schwartz’s plan adapts “subsoiling” – a technique commonly used in agriculture to break up the shallow compaction of soil that develops when farm vehicles go back and forth across fields. The researchers at CUERE are using deep ripping with heavy steel blades ripping (18 to 24 inches down) to pulverize the soil then they till organic material compost back into the ground.</p>
    <p>The technique likely won’t have immediate applications in small residential yards where deep ripping would also tear up water, gas, and electrical utilities, though Schwartz says that in the right conditions (utilities on one side of houses, for instance), a collection of 25 to 50 homeowners on the same street who agreed to have it done might provide the proper economy of scale.</p>
    <p>So in the meantime, Schwartz and his colleagues have secured a grant to test their method on vacant lots in Baltimore City where access is easier to obtain – and the researchers can also test other sustainable methods aimed at reducing pollutants even further.</p>
    <p>Schwartz says that the tests on vacant lots are “also incorporating biochar, a very specialized form of black carbon, which has a high affinity for binding certain pollutants.”</p>
    <p>Indeed, biochar might turn such sample lots (and any other space in which it is employed) into high-performance pollutant filters that will retain hydrocarbons, heavy metals and nutrients above and beyond what a normal soil can hold.</p>
    <p>To accelerate the adoption of the deep ripping technique, the CUERE researchers hope to convince developers to use subsoiling at the time of building construction. Though challenges such as demolition debris that might pose constraints to deep ripping do remain, such collaborations would achieve the goal of reducing runoff and also minimize costs, since the technique requires just a little bit of extra time, an inexpensive commodity (compost) and a piece of equipment typically onsite already.</p>
